چکیده مقاله:

IEEE-802.11 standard, as the dominant wireless technology, has extended its usage to Industrial Networks. Various physical layer modulation schemes have been defined inthe standard, but only the simplest ones, like DBPSK, has been thoroughly studied in the literature. OFDM on the other hand,has proven performance in fading channels, which is a common phenomenon in noisy industrial environment. In this paper, performance evaluation of the OFDM modulation, in variousnetwork scenarios including number of competing nodes, packet payload, SNR, and retry limit, has been thoroughly studied.Delay metrics including average, maximum, and jitter has been considered. Simulation results show significant outperformanceof OFDM for typical short packet payloads in industrial networks (8 to 32 Bytes). It is worth noting that at larger datapayloads (e.g. 64-Byte and above), the simple DBPSK provides better performance at noisy and fading environment
